Attic Bathroom Remodeling in Lancaster, PA
Attic bathroom remodeling services focus on transforming unused or underutilized attic spaces into functional, comfortable bathrooms. These projects typically involve installing plumbing, electrical wiring, ventilation, and fixtures to create a fully operational bathroom within the attic area. Homeowners often seek these renovations to maximize space, add convenience, or increase property value by converting an attic into a private bathroom suite or guest space.
Before requesting attic bathroom remodeling, property owners should consider factors such as the existing structural integrity, accessibility, and the feasibility of adding plumbing and electrical systems in the attic. It’s important to evaluate the available space, determine the desired layout, and understand any necessary permits or building codes that may apply. Clear planning ensures the project aligns with both functional needs and the home's overall design.

Common Attic Bathroom Remodeling Jobs
Attic bathroom conversions - transforming attic spaces into functional bathrooms for added convenience.
Small bathroom remodels - updating compact attic bathrooms with modern fixtures and layouts.
Full bathroom renovations - completely overhauling attic bathrooms to improve style and functionality.
Fixture upgrades - replacing sinks, toilets, and showers to enhance comfort and efficiency.
Waterproofing and insulation - ensuring attic bathrooms are protected from moisture and temperature issues.
Lighting and ventilation improvements - optimizing airflow and lighting for a safer, more comfortable space.
Attic Bathroom Remodeling Questions
What are common upgrades for attic bathroom remodeling? Typical upgrades include new fixtures, improved lighting, tile flooring, and enhanced ventilation systems.
Is additional insulation needed during attic bathroom renovation? Yes, adding insulation can improve energy efficiency and comfort in the space.
Can existing plumbing be used in attic bathroom remodels? Often, existing plumbing can be adapted, but updates may be necessary for newer fixtures or layouts.
What should property owners consider before starting an attic bathroom project? It's important to assess space layout, ventilation options, and access to existing utilities before beginning.
